The Importance of Music in Advertising
Advertising music plays a vital role in capturing attention, evoking feelings, and increasing memorability. Picking suitable music can change a basic advertisement into a powerful brand message that sticks in the minds of customers.

Tips for Picking Music in Advertising
Selecting advertising music needs insight into your customers, brand identity, and the campaign’s message. The music should:
- Reflect the tone – happy, relaxed, intense, or fun, depending on the ad’s style.
- Reflect your brand’s values – traditional, modern, innovative, or trustworthy.
- Resonate with your audience – fitting the preferences of your viewers.
- Support the narrative – making the ad more engaging.
Pros and Cons of Music Options
Music for ads can be either bespoke or licensed. Original music provides a unique sound, but can be require more resources. Licensed music is ready-made and familiar but needs careful copyright management.

Current Advertising Music Trends
Minimalistic music and ambient sounds are growing in popularity that creates mood without distraction. Also, more brands partner with independent musicians to create authentic connections.

Avoiding Copyright Issues
Understanding licensing is crucial to prevent infringement. This includes sync rights, public performance rights, and mechanical rights, depending on where and how the ad is shown.
